What skills, knowledge and experience will you need?



  • Significant demonstrable expertise in Front-end development of large-scale systems dealing with high numbers of users, transactions and business processes.
  • Detailed working knowledge and extensive experience of open-source technologies including HTML, CSS, client and server-side JavaScript, TypeScriptNode.js and other modern front-end frameworks and templating languages.
  • Experience in building accessible compliant user interfaces.
  • Proven ability in delivering thorough unit level test coverage using common testing frameworks such as Jest or Mocha.
  • Experience integrating with a wide range of technical systems including database technologies (SQL or NoSQL), caching tools such as Redis and API Microservices, all deploying into cloud-based infrastructure. (AWS or Azure).
  • Influential and able to lead front-end activities, set and develop best practice for an agile team and contribute across multiple teams. You will ensure consistency whilst promoting standards as well as creating a coaching and mentoring culture.




You and your role



As a Front End Developer you'll be part of our brilliant Engineering community.



You will need strong knowledge of modern web development stacks, web standards, user experience, progressive enhancement, performance, accessibility, browser compatibility, tooling and pipelines.



You will be working with cross-functional teams to integrate into the back-end services to ensure that they are built to the same high standards. Whilst ensuring we develop accessible user interfaces for DWP services which work effectively across multiple devices and browsers.



You will be leading and promoting the technical direction and development of reusable patterns and components.



You will be using modern tooling and development techniques to write and share test-driven code, which we deliver iteratively.



Your work will be an enabler for multiple teams, driving consistency, standards, pace and quality, resolving technical blockers, and promoting re-use and collaboration through the wider communities.
